A hand-held dual liquid medication injector (100, 400) having dual, bi-directional dosage metering mechanisms (252, 253, 410) for permitting a variable dosage amount for each cartridge (104, 106) of liquid medication. The medications are mixed within a manifold (122) having a valved mixing chamber (14) and are injected via a single cannula (121). The mixing chamber is valved (136) such that backflow of mixed or unmixed medications into the cartridges is prevented. An injection mechanism (116, 254, 412), independent of the metering mechanism, loads and injects the liquid medication. In one embodiment, transverse movement of the injection mechanism (116) during injection is translated into horizontal movement by the plunger mechanism. In another embodiment, a power-assisted plunger mechanism (412) accomplishes injection.
